CARTERTON NEWS.

.—* Mr. C. Whyto, of tho local Post-Office staff, has received notice of transfer to Wellington, and leaves shortly to tak« up his new duties. Miss Graham,*of Carterton, leaves on Thursdnv morning for Wellington, en route for Australia, wihero she intends to take up resilience. A number of her friends assembled at tho residence of Mrs. A. King, on Friday afternoon, and presented her with a. handsome writing case as a token of esteem. _ ' Miss Brown, of the local Post Office stall, leaves on a month's holiday on- Fn- ..- day next, and will visit Sydney and Melbourne. ~- L » The heifer winch formed the subject of tho guessing competition at tho \Vairarnpa show on Thursday, weighed 5491b. The two sheep wcigJied 14611b., and tho pig IMb. The tickets will bo examined on Monday, and tho winners declared.
